This commit addresses a high-severity path traversal vulnerability in the telemetry and dashboard modules. By sanitizing `run_id` inputs using `Path(run_id).name`, we ensure that file operations are restricted to the intended `runs/` directory, preventing unauthorized access to other parts of the filesystem. Key changes: - Sanitized `run_id` in `heidi_engine/telemetry.py` and `heidi_engine/dashboard.py`. - Fixed a `NameError` in `telemetry.get_state` caused by broken cache logic. - Standardized `AUTOTRAIN_DIR` default value across modules. - Modernized `datetime.utcnow()` calls to use `datetime.now(timezone.utc)`. - Added regression tests in `tests/test_security.py`. - Documented findings in `.jules/sentinel.md`.

While this if __name__ == '__main__': block allows for direct execution of the script, it's redundant when using a test runner like pytest, which is already imported. The test runner will automatically discover and execute functions prefixed with test_. Relying solely on the test runner is a best practice that ensures tests are run in a consistent environment with proper setup, teardown, and reporting. I suggest removing this block to encourage the use of pytest for test execution.
